Ham is a hamlet near the town of Sandwich in Kent within the parish of Northbourne. Places to eat in the region include Samphire Restaurant, Blazing Donkey, Eastry Fish Bar, and St Crispin Inn.
The center of Ham ( which is at is longitude 1°19'48 and latitude 51°14'42 ) is located 1 mile away from Eastry, 3 miles away from Sandwich, 4 miles away from Ripple and 4 miles away from Staple.

St Crispin Inn ( Dining / Pubs / Bars ). The St Crispin Inn is a 15th century traditional pub which also offers quiet en suite B&B accommodation with free WiFi internet access. It is located in the small country village of Word in Worth, only a mile or so from the mediaeval cinque port of Sandwich, in an area that was notorious for smugglers, who were known to frequent the Inn.
